Web10 de abr. de 2024 · The biggest goldfish ever recorded belonged to a man in the Netherlands and was measured at 18.7 inches long in 2003. Goldfish that are more than … Web13 de out. de 2024 · The average Ryukin Goldfish size is usually about six to eight inches long when healthy. However, it’s not uncommon to see specimens bigger than that. Like many other types of goldfish, the Ryukin is capable of growing slightly bigger when kept in a spacious habitat. Those housed in outdoor ponds can sometimes get as big as 10 …

If you're willing to invest in the long-term needs of your carnival goldfish, he may live in excess of 20 years. The longest-lived known carnival goldfish was won from a fair in Yorkshire, England in 1956. The fish lived until 1999, dying at the age of 43 years old. 00:02 01:42. green bay packers kids clothes
